This position is based at MOJ Buchanan Wharf, G5 8AQ Job Summary Please refer to Job Description Job Description The Role You will report to the Director of Operations. You will have overall responsibility for a number of casework and decision-making teams. You will ensure that work is carried out consistently and effectively, to facilitate the achievement of team objectives. The Key Responsibilities Of The Role Are As Follows: Managing and providing leadership within your area, to ensure delivery of a high-quality service that keeps the customer at the heart of everything we do Monitoring the management of people performance through regular communication within your management team and having overarching responsibility for people development and wellbeing, ensuring your people are fully supported Ensuring that your area makes a valuable contribution to meeting CICA business objectives and KPIs, through the monitoring of Management Information Play a key role in the operational delivery senior management team, both at a strategic and operational level Demonstrating commitment to the Business Plan, through driving continuous improvement in collaboration with colleagues across all business areas Responsibility within your area for adherence to all MoJ Polices Responsibility for building and maintaining effective relationships with external stakeholders such as His Majesty’s Court and Tribunal Services (HMCTS), Police, Victim Support Services, GPs etc Other Duties The post holder is required to work in a flexible way and undertake any other duties reasonably requested by line management which are commensurate with the grade and level of responsibility of this post. Nationality requirements This Job Is Broadly Open To The Following Groups: UK nationals nationals of the Republic of Ireland nationals of Commonwealth countries who have the right to work in the UK nationals of the EU, Switzerland, Norway, Iceland or Liechtenstein and family members of those nationalities with settled or pre-settled status under the European Union Settlement Scheme (EUSS) (opens in a new window) nationals of the EU, Switzerland, Norway, Iceland or Liechtenstein and family members of those nationalities who have made a valid application for settled or pre-settled status under the European Union Settlement Scheme (EUSS) individuals with limited leave to remain or indefinite leave to remain who were eligible to apply for EUSS on or before 31 December 2020 Turkish nationals, and certain family members of Turkish nationals, who have accrued the right to work in the Civil Service Further information on nationality requirements (opens in a new window) Working for the Civil Service The Civil Service Code (opens in a new window) sets out the standards of behaviour expected of civil servants. We recruit by merit on the basis of fair and open competition, as outlined in the Civil Service Commission's recruitment principles (opens in a new window). The Civil Service embraces diversity and promotes equal opportunities. As such, we run a Disability Confident Scheme (DCS) for candidates with disabilities who meet the minimum selection criteria. The Civil Service also offers a Redeployment Interview Scheme to civil servants who are at risk of redundancy, and who meet the minimum requirements for the advertised vacancy.
